Greetings, Kevin here.


Just signed up and have to say that I was particularly impressed by all the work done on the CPC Wiki (which brought me here). I'd consider myself more of an interloper as although I do own a CPC 464, I've been winding down my collection and back in the day was more of a C64 man!!


However, I have come across some CPC mags and zines and thought I'd offer to scan them if there was any interest here. You seem to have a lot of these covered, but maybe there is a few things you could add to your Wiki.


Amstrad Cent pour Cent - Issues 6, 25, 35, 40-44, 46-49
Amstrad Software & Peripheral Catalogue 1986
LFACC 'zine Issue 2 18 Mar 1991
Eurostrad 'zine Issue 5 1994
Eureka 'zine No 3 Sep 1992
CPC-Fastloader No 4
Rundschlag - Issues 7-9, 16 & 17 and also a preview edition of issue 7.0 which seems to have been made available during a Euromeeting in REIMS in 1992 (this has fewer pages than the proper issue 7 and has hand-written notes on the front which says "Only a temporary preview edition for Euromeeting in Reims. Thanks to Logon System and Niki of Eureka." Signed by Marabu of HJT and Hiroyuki and dated 25/7/1992.


Anyway, keep up the good work and if there is any interest I'm only too happy to scan these for you.
